Sum of smallest parts of all partitions of n into odd distinct parts. |

FORMULA
|
G.f.: Sum((2*n-1)*x^(2*n-1)*Product(1+x^(2*k+1), k = n .. infinity), n = 1 .. infinity).
|
|
EXAMPLE
|
a(13)=15 because the partitions of 13 into distinct odd parts are [13],[9,3,1] and [7,5,1], with sum of the smallest terms 13+1+1=15.
